html,body{font-family:sans-serif;font-size:14px;color:#3B3B3B;line-height:165%}body{background:#E9EBEB;font-family:'Conv_Aller_Rg',Sans-Serif}p{margin-bottom:17px}.ss-icon{vertical-align:middle}@font-face{font-family:'Conv_Aller_Rg';src:url('/assets/fonts/Aller_Rg.eot');src:local('☺'), url('/assets/fonts/Aller_Rg.woff') format('woff'), url('/assets/fonts/Aller_Rg.ttf') format('truetype'), url('/assets/fonts/Aller_Rg.svg') format('svg');font-weight:normal;font-style:normal}@font-face{font-family:'Conv_Aller_Bd';src:url('/assets/fonts/Aller_Bd.eot');src:local('☺'), url('/assets/fonts/Aller_Bd.woff') format('woff'), url('/assets/fonts/Aller_Bd.ttf') format('truetype'), url('/assets/fonts/Aller_Bd.svg') format('svg');font-weight:normal;font-style:normal}@font-face{font-family:'Conv_Aller_Lt';src:url('/assets/fonts/Aller_Lt.eot');src:local('☺'), url('/assets/fonts/Aller_Lt.woff') format('woff'), url('/assets/fonts/Aller_Lt.ttf') format('truetype'), url('/assets/fonts/Aller_Lt.svg') format('svg');font-weight:normal;font-style:normal}#content{background:#fff;border-top:20px solid #676766}#banner{margin-bottom:45px}header{padding:20px
60px 30px 60px}.phone{font-family:'Conv_Aller_Lt',Sans-Serif;float:right;padding-left:40px;font-size:24px;color:#676766;height:37px;line-height:37px;background:url('/assets/images/phone.png') no-repeat}header
.phone{margin-top:45px}body.mobile{background:white;width:auto;min-width:auto}body.mobile{font-size:17px;padding:20px}#logo-mobile{text-align:center;margin:20px
20px 40px 0;0}.mobile
div.contact{margin:26px
0 16px 0}.mobile
ul{margin-bottom:16px;padding:0
0 16px 25px;border-bottom:1px solid #4E6F84}.mobile
.full{margin:10px
0;text-align:right;width:120px;color:#fff;text-align:center}.mobile .full
a{color:#fff;text-decoration:none}.contact .ss-icon,i.ss-check{color:#1B897D}.mobile
div.more{display:none}.mobile
p.more{cursor:pointer}#content{border:none}a{color:#3C3C3C}h1,h2,h3,h4,h5{font-weight:normal;text-transform:uppercase;color:#009b95;margin-bottom:16px}h1{font-size:18px}h5{font-size:14px;margin-bottom:0}.divider{border-top:2px solid #009b95;padding-top:12px}.follow_on{margin-top:50px}.linebelow{border-bottom:2px solid #009b95;padding-bottom:12px;padding-top:20px;text-transform:none}.nobannertop{margin-top:50px}nav
a{height:55px;line-height:55px;background:#ccc;float:right;width:222px;text-align:center;border-bottom-right-radius:30px 30px;margin-left: -30px}nav
a{text-decoration:none;color:#3B3B3B;text-transform:uppercase;-o-transition:.2s;-ms-transition:.2s;-moz-transition:.2s;-webkit-transition:.2s;transition:.2s;text-decoration:none;color:#3B3B3B}.phone a,a.number{text-decoration:none;color:#3C3C3C}nav a
span{margin-left:10px}nav a.home
span{margin-left:0}nav a:hover{color:#fff}nav
a.home{margin-left:0;width:192px;background:#118072}nav
a.about{background:#00aaa6}nav
a.services{background:#54bbb9}nav
a.info{background:#90cfce}nav
a.contact{background:#c6e5e4;border-bottom-right-radius:0}nav
a.active{background:#fff;color:#009b95}.services
div#banner{margin-bottom:0}.service{display:none}.service.intro{display:block}div.subnav{float:left;background:#c6e5e4;width:300px;border-bottom-right-radius:30px 30px}div.subnav
ul{margin-top:50px;margin-bottom:50px}div.subnav ul
li{font-size:15px;font-weight:normal;text-transform:uppercase;margin:0
0 18px 30px}div.subnav ul li
i{margin-right:6px}div.subnav ul li
a{cursor:pointer;text-decoration:none}div.subnav ul li.active
a{color:#009b95}em{font-style:normal;color:#009b95}img.services_intro{width:260px;float:left}.services
blockquote{margin-left:315px;color:#3B3B3B}.feature_panel,.home_features>div{text-align:center;margin:20px
0 40px 32px;border-bottom-right-radius:30px 30px;height:160px;float:left;background:#B8DBD3;width:265px}.feature_panel h2,
.feature_panel
h3{text-align:left;font-size:18px;text-transform:none;margin:10px
0 0 25px}.feature_panel
h3{margin-top:5px;color:#333}.feature_panel
p{text-align:left;margin:5px
20px 10px 25px}.download
h2{font-size:60px;line-height:105px;text-align:center;margin-left:0}div.first{margin-left:0}.feature_panel > a,
.home_features .who a,.button{font-size:13px;margin:10px
auto 0 auto;color:#fff;text-decoration:none;padding:4px
20px;background:#626363;border-radius:8px 8px}.home_features .who a,.button{padding:4px
14px}.feature_panel > a:hover,
.home_features .who a:hover,.button:hover{background:#009b95}.right_column
img{display:block;margin-bottom:20px}.right_column
blockquote{margin:20px
0}.person{margin-bottom:30px;clear:both}.person
h2{position:relative;color:#3C3C3C;cursor:pointer}.person .ss-icon{position:absolute;left:-20px;color:#3C3C3C}.person h2.active, .person .ss-dropdown{color:#009b95}.person
p{display:none;margin-left:180px}.person
img{float:left;width:130px;padding:0
50px 30px 0}.person p.title, .person h2, .person
span{margin:0
0 0 180px;display:block}.person
p.title{font-family:'Conv_Aller_Bd',Sans-Serif;border-bottom:2px solid #009b95;margin-bottom:18px}.person
span{margin-bottom:12px;font-style:italic}.faq
h2{cursor:pointer;color:#3C3C3C}.faq
p{display:none}.faq ul li
a{cursor:pointer;text-decoration:none;color:#3B3B3B}.faq
i{margin-right:8px}.faq
h2.active{color:#009b95}.contact_detail{width:200px}.contact
h2{font-size:17px;margin-top:4px;text-transform:none}.contact .left_column
h2{margin-bottom:4px}.contact
.transport{margin-left:40px;width:265px}.link
h5{text-decoration:none;margin-bottom:0}.link{margin-bottom:10px}blockquote
cite{display:block;font-size:14px;font-style:normal;font-family:'Conv_Aller_Rg',Sans-Serif;color:#626363}blockquote{text-align:right;font-size:28px;color:#009b95;font-family:'Junge',serif;line-height:42px;padding-right:43px;position:relative;margin:0
0 0 10px}blockquote
span{color:#ccc;font-size:80px;position:absolute}blockquote
span.rquote{bottom:25px;right:0}blockquote
span.lquote{top:10px;left: -25px;position:absolute}.about blockquote
span.rquote{}.services
blockquote{font-size:18px}.services blockquote
span.rquote{}.services blockquote
span.lquote{}.home_features>div{height:auto;background:none}.home_features > div.open h2, .home_features > div.call_us h2, .info .call_us h2, .contact .call_us
h2{text-align:left;margin-left:20px;font-size:26px;text-transform:none;margin-top:20px;line-height:36px}.home_features > div.call_us .phone, .right_column
.phone{margin-left:30px;float:left}.contact .call_us, .info
.call_us{width:220px}.contact .opn h2, .info .call_us h2,  .info .open
h2{margin-top:0;margin-left:0}.contact .call_us .phone, .info .call_us
.phone{margin-top:0;margin-left:0}.home_features h1, .home_features h5, .home_features
p{text-align:left}.home_features
img{float:left;width:80px}.home_features
.who{text-align:left }.home_features .who p, .home_features .who
a{margin-left:100px}.home_features
.open{text-align:left }.home_features .open
p{}#map{float:none;width:265px;height:200px;background:#B8DBD3;border:1px
solid #ccc;margin-bottom:14px}.contact
#map{height:265px;float:right}.left_column{padding-left:35px}.right_column{padding-left:35px}footer{margin-top:90px;background:#ccc;font-family:'Conv_Aller_Rg',Sans-Serif;padding-top:20px;padding-bottom:30px}.copyright{float:right}footer
span{margin:0
60px 0 60px;text-align:center}.payment_images{float:right;padding-left:2px}